Favre-Leuba is one of the oldest Swiss watch brands in existence, founded in 1737 in Le Locle — making it over 285 years deep in the game before most watch brands were even a thought. The brand had a legendary run producing dress watches, tool watches, and everything in between, before eventually going dormant in the late 20th century. After decades of silence, Favre-Leuba was revived in 2011 under new ownership and attempted a comeback — but ultimately ceased production again around 2020, closing the chapter on active manufacturing.
